Family of Earth: A Celebration

September 11, 2016 @ 3:00 p.m. – 4:00 p.m. | Open to public with donations accepted

After the death of renowned writer and environmentalist Wilma Dykeman Stokely in 2006, a typewritten manuscript was discovered among her papers. To celebrate its publication, her sons, Jim and Dykeman Stokely, will speak at the East Tennessee History Center.

The event, which is is free, is made possible by Friends of the Knox County Public Library, Union Ave Books, the Library Society of UT, the East Tennessee Historical Society and the Knox County Public Library. Copies of the memoir, “Family of Earth: A Southern Mountain Childhood,” will be available for purchase, and donations will be accepted to help the ongoing efforts of the organization.
